How long have you had your bag? My experience with the NCStar was that the should straps will start coming part at the seams and the quality just isn’t there for rougher handling. If I just carry from the truck to the bed, bench, or what have you, it’s ok and there is no stress introduced and it seems all the weight is around the handles. But if you start stressing components it start tearing. If you have some hard usage and start stressing components, it will start to come apart on you. Does it need to be a soft case? I’m not sure how much room is in the caravan stow and go but…I bought one of the Plano field locker cases, it would hold 2 rifles if they don’t have large scopes. I have a pelican case and 2 of the pelican/hardigg cases and I’ll say this Plano case is about 90% of a pelican for 50% of the cost…$78 at their outlet store, prob a bit more from amazon or wherever
Forgot to add…my pelican/hardigg cases came with fitted soft cases inside with a padded divider for 2 rifles. Kinda spendy but it’s really nice. Big enough it folds out into a shooting mat even. Pretty sure you can buy just the soft case alone
